Modern oil slip resistant shoes incorporate ergonomic arch support and lightweight materials to reduce fatigue. Steel or composite toe caps that meet safety standards without sacrificing the flexibility needed for a natural gait.
The soles feature deep, multidirectional lugs that act like treads on a tire, channeling liquids away from the point of contact. Today’s oil slip resistant shoes offer a range of styles that cater to both industrial and urban settings.

This engineered tread pattern, combined with a high coefficient of friction, ensures that the shoe grips the ground rather than sliding, providing stability on polished concrete or slick metal surfaces. In manufacturing plants, automotive repair shops, and food processing facilities, the risk of oil spills is constant.
